First off leveling skills evenly just isn’t that efficient , but you have 3 options 1:W-Q-E-W-W-R-W-W maximizing poke and mobility I rarely every do the W max unless the enemy bot lane is a tank support/and Adc are garbage at trading and Agro 2:W-Q-E-W-W-R then max E after 6 I usually do this vs Matchups like Alistar,Leona,Tahm Kench,Braum, Pretty much any tank if I can get away with it 3:W-Q-E max straight away against scaling lanes like other enchanter class supports or hard matchups that I take item 3301 On that I know I wont be able to take even trades with I just look to survive in lane

Now for some of the matchups that I love Janna into Pyke Leona Rakan , All 3 of these champs you can negate their CC with your Q and are open to a lot of poke from your W and Autos . Thresh Morgana Blitzcrank Braum Some hook and heavy engage matchups that pretty much just require you and your ADC to dodge and for you to peel hard CC if your adc gets hooked or take a Morgana Q

Fiddlesticks Xerath Zyra Brand These are all the matchups that are difficult for me and that require for you to survive the laning phase . Your early game shield isn’t enough to sustain the damage that these champions inflict and I will usually rush item 3174 first item to get some extra magic resist so your goals for this lane is to survive into mid game and wait for Ganks from your jungler/Mid Laner to get ahead in lane

Didn’t cover every support champion but those are just some detailed tips and information from my own personal experience from them .

Now in my opinion , Janna does 2 things better than pretty much any other support champion in the game and this includes peeling and warding . Her Q should only be used for poke if you are pressuring a tower and the enemies are already low in my opinion. Other than that your Q should only be used to peel you and your ADC from ganks and from any other enemy engages , its your best tool to keep you and your teammates alive other than your ultimate . Use your W and auto attacks to poke but save your Q. And this leads be to my 2nd point of warding . I have a higher Vision score on Janna per game than I do on any other support because of her increadible mobility and peel . You can use this to Ward more aggressively as in enemy territory because of your ability to escape by self peeling .

Vision is so undervalued and is so important to you and your teams success if they decide to take advantage of the wards that you give them . Pink wards by every support in every elo should be buying a MINIMUM of 1 Control ward per/5 minutes in my opinion . On average I buy 10 a game and I leave my last item slowly open for pinks at the end of the game just to hold 2 pink wards

I do not often hang out in the backline as Janna, I prefer to move around alot and ward and be in the fight, many times I love tanky stats to allow me the freedom to move around in a teamfight and atleast take a few hits without dying this also makes it alot easier to get into somones face fast to interuppt something for example a channeled high dmg ult like Miss fortune or velkoz. This being said I value tanky stats high but I do not build full tank either.

I buy Ardent Censer if I have an adc that scales really well with attack speed... for example Vayne, cait, Jinx or Ashe or if I have a very snowballed Yasuo in a lane or something like that. You will help them to carry you so find who on the map you think is best equipped to do so and play around that. However the only time I personally would find it to be a bad thing to buy this item is if your team is very ap heavy in which case I dont think I would have picked Janna anyway. She loves this item becouse her E gives ad to combine that steroid with AS can be very very strong. So certain items can have different impact on different supports.

I buy Redemption when enemy team has strong aoe or ardent censer is not a good option sometimes I build it anyway becouse why not? you can potentially get a heal off for your whole team so it is not a bad item + it gives you slightly higher hp which is something I would value very high unless I can dodge like everything which isnt human so. Redemption is not very effective against very high burst however since that would mean you have to pre cast redemtion before the nuke which yeah isnt always that easy to pull off.
